On Mon, Aug 10, 2026, Sean Christopherson wrote:
> From: David Woodhouse <dwmw@amazon.co.uk>
>
> Commit 53fafdbb8b21 ("KVM: x86: switch KVMCLOCK base to monotonic raw
> clock") did so only for 64-bit hosts, by capturing the boot offset from
> within the existing clocksource notifier update_pvclock_gtod().
>
> That notifier was added in commit 16e8d74d2da9 ("KVM: x86: notifier for
> clocksource changes") but only on x86_64, because its original purpose
> was just to disable the "master clock" mode which is only supported on
> x86_64.
>
> Now that the notifier is used for more than disabling master clock mode,
> enable it for the 32-bit build too so that get_kvmclock_base_ns() can be
> unaffected by NTP sync on 32-bit too.

From https://sashiko.dev/#/patchset/20260810225500.869288-1-seanjc%40google.com:
: Does this add unnecessary overhead to the timekeeper update path on 32-bit
: builds?
:
: The commit message notes a rebase on top of ktime_mono_to_any() usage. Because
: of that rebase, get_kvmclock_base_ns() now uses ktime_mono_to_any() directly
: and no longer reads from pvclock_gtod_data.
:
: Since all other readers of pvclock_gtod_data remain guarded by CONFIG_X86_64,
: is pvclock_gtod_data now effectively write-only on 32-bit? This would mean
: update_pvclock_gtod() runs on every host core timekeeping update just to
: populate an unused struct.
Huh. Indeed. Now that "Compute kvmclock base without pvclock_gtod_data" will
land before this patch, there's no need to register KVM's notifier on 32-bit,
and this patch is simply:
diff --git arch/x86/kvm/x86.c arch/x86/kvm/x86.c
index 67c762b3bf28..edafe13f74cf 100644
--- arch/x86/kvm/x86.c
+++ arch/x86/kvm/x86.c
@@ -926,19 +926,13 @@ static void update_pvclock_gtod(struct timekeeper *tk)
write_seqcount_end(&vdata->seq);
}
+#endif
static s64 get_kvmclock_base_ns(void)
{
/* Count up from boot time, but with the frequency of the raw clock. */
return ktime_to_ns(ktime_mono_to_any(ktime_get_raw(), TK_OFFS_BOOT));
}
-#else
-static s64 get_kvmclock_base_ns(void)
-{
- /* Master clock not used, so we can just use CLOCK_BOOTTIME. */
- return ktime_get_boottime_ns();
-}
-#endif
static uint32_t div_frac(uint32_t dividend, uint32_t divisor)
{
I'll post a v10, since this is a non-trivial change.
